Rod Argent had scored a hit with his group, the Zombies, earlier with “She’s Not There”. Argent was one of the early practitioners of electric keyboard, and that made his sound special. This came in at #6 on March 9, 1965.

The Zombies: “Tell Her No”

Who could forget the Beatles? Today remembered by Generation X and Y as Paul McCartney’s first backup band, they defined the Sixties. To his credit, McCartney agonized over his songs just as Gershwin and the other great songwriters did. This came in at #5 on March 9, 1965.

The Beatles: “Eight Days a Week”
